Output 043e9d40656d861c486c041a40b13fdb0efdabd55e0faba06069d8bebc2659d5:0

value
89049367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95a3c433b285f0fb9bf22546c8440942324287b OP_EQUAL
address
MPLcXWq2zwFpezg4SqBDEcSk19UTYuwYJq
transaction
043e9d40656d861c486c041a40b13fdb0efdabd55e0faba06069d8bebc2659d5
spent
true